Irish star Shahira Barry claims Galway accent has stopped her from getting acting roles in Los Angeles

Shahira Barry has claimed that her Irish accent has cost her from getting roles while working in LA.

The popular influencer has been living in Hollywood for the last five years and has appeared in flicks such as Ted 2, while she has also worked as Kim Kardashian’s body double.

Despite her relative career success to date, the Galway woman says she has not always found it easy to find work - partially due to her thick Irish accent.

Speaking to the Irish Sun, she said: "Acting in LA is proving pretty difficult when you still have an Irish accent. I find turning off my natural accent very difficult to do.

“However, I am still on the casting and audition merry-go-round.

“I audition a couple of times every week and I’m hopeful that the right role will come along.”

Despite these minor difficulties, Shahira says she is enjoying her newfound lifestyle in LA and has recently given up booze.

She added: "I wanted to give up for the longest time, literally years, and I must have said it about 1,000 times before I actually did it!

“I was definitely the type who would drink on a night out and the next day regret it and be like, ‘Whyyyy... I’m never drinking again!!!’ But then the next event would roll around and it would be the same thing."
